Sir - After reading the report on Peter Jackson's 'unannounced' visit to Goole Town Council, it does make you wonder if in fact he and Sally Burns work for the same directorate. When Sally Burns gave her very popular, public speech at GTC, where the room was bursting with eager listeners, she clearly stated that Richard Cooper Street and Phoenix Street were not only on target but indeed well within budget.
Along with painting this perfect little Utopia where everyone will wish to live, she has also dismissed GAG as a few mouthy objectors with no clout.
Then Peter Jackson arrived unannounced and apparently blamed everyone under the sun for this failing, sinking, no-plan project - apart from himself.
Lord Heath used to have mad tantrums, which colleagues would put down to an 'ageing politician who had lost the plot'. Can we see any similarities to Mr Jackson's outburst?
